Looking at a Senior Data Scientist position from GoDaddy (Level 3) and ML Engineer (IC3) from Yelp.

To add more context, GD role is focussed towards ML experimentations and building impactful trained ML model, and working with Engineers to Ship. Where ML Engineer role is more of your regular MLE role I am assuming.

GD and Yelp both 1st year TC: 170 (very similar except couple of thousands). Includes Base, bonus, RSU and Signon

Which one has better future career prospects as an ML person? My background is in Applied ML Research with 5YOE.

Liked the GD team and manager. As with Yelp I liked how their process is well organized and smooth.

Any thoughts?

    Is this in Canada? I’ll assume it is.

    170k CAD TC for IC3 is low in Canada. You can probably negotiate to +200k TC with both GD and Yelp offers.

    IC3s at Yelp should be getting +200k CAD anyway.

      I joined Yelp as IC3 in 2021 and my TC is C$188k (base + annual RSU, bonus not included). You can confidently ask for C$200k+
